About the Guest:

Jerry Bowman is the CEO of Partners In Action, a Christ-centered, non-profit agency engaged in partnering with local, national, and international people and agencies that are providing care and support to the most needy in the world.
Partners in Action deploys resources and creates opportunities for people to serve those in need around the corner and around the world so they may have a LIFE. Partners in Action (PIA) is a global Christ centered nonprofit that partners with ministries in 25 countries including over 50 orphanages.

PIA helped acquire the town of Bulembu Swaziland to create a self-sustaining town to be home to 3,000 orphans by 2020.
